What is Buddy Break?
Buddy Break is a FREE respite program designed to give caregivers of kids with special needs (VIP kids) a break from their ongoing care-giving responsibilities for three hours on Saturday mornings. Each VIP kid at Buddy Break is paired up with a Buddy for one-on-one attention as everyone has fun playing games, hearing and seeing great children's stories, videos, music and more...and the caregivers get a break!
Who are VIP kids?
VIPs are kids with special needs which include any physical, cognitive, medical or hidden disability, chronic or life-threatening illness, or those who are medically fragile. This program is for VIP children birth ages: 2-16 years old, and their siblings: 4 years old to 5th grade.
Why is there a need for respite care?
The weight of finding proper doctors, teachers, and financial resources for a child's care can take a tremendous toll on a family of a child with special needs. Those responsibilities, as well as the never-ending demands for daily care of a child, are squeezed into days already filled with the demands of caring for a household, siblings, and self. Opportunities for caregivers to take time for themselves, run errands, or plan special one-on-one outings with children or a spouse are rare.

Because we treasure each child's uniqueness, we require that parents attend an orientation and fill out a detailed notebook on their child. This helps our Buddies to give specialized care. We also require that Buddies attend a mandatory Buddy training class prior to serving at Buddy Break.
